программа печати конвертов и уведомлений к ним
|
|
адвокат | Дата: Пятница, 25.12.2009, 17:06 | Сообщение # 1 |
Группа: Пользователи
Сообщений: 10
Статус: Offline
| Господа товарищи, программисты и программистски, я понимаю, что моя проблема скорее не является таковой... однако, у меня встал вопрос: я несколько увлекаюсь написанием программ в таблицах типа ОпенОфиса и Excel. ситуация такова, до определённого момента я работал в опене. но став обладателем пакета с Excel-ем, решил вспомнить старое и попробовать написать аналогичное. проблема в том, что до этого у меня был Excel-2003, сейчас Excel-2007... что я хочу узнать (тупая помощь - типа я сделал пользуйся - приветствуется, но хотелось бы понять суть).... 1. возможно ли в Excel-2007 сделать пользовательское меню (типа окна меню в котором будет возможность выбора из данных с другой страницы) - и как это сделать - где почитать 2. как сделать что бы выпадающие ячейки кроме тех данных, что выбираются с другого листа добавляли еще рядом расположенные данные. (понимаю, что звучит сумбурно, но что бы было понятно прикладываю файл) Ссылка для скачивания файла Печать конвертов OpenOffice.xls http://file.qip.ru/file/113721235/8360ca57/__OpenOffice.html ( 250.5 Кб ) (и еще - почему то перестал работать макрос в опене. до определенного времени работал и умер. понимаю что не в тему, но если вы поймете почему - буду рад за подсказку. нужна будет моя помощь - ICQ#: 249546690) прошу прощения за развернутое повествование. просто сложно описать техническим языком, то что нужно.
|
|
|
|
адвокат | Дата: Понедельник, 28.12.2009, 18:27 | Сообщение # 2 |
Группа: Пользователи
Сообщений: 10
Статус: Offline
| По сути все уже сделано… Осталось дело за малым. По существу листы будут сделаны по формату – как положено… То есть печать рабочей области будет достаточно… Если не сложно помогите подвязать с помощью макроса кнопку печать с выбором печати и листами подлежащими печати. И еще на листе 220х110 не умещается текст – возможно ли его как то поделить между строчками…. см. ниже... Заранее спасибо
Сообщение отредактировал адвокат - Вторник, 29.12.2009, 17:21 |
|
|
|
sizop | Дата: Вторник, 29.12.2009, 08:48 | Сообщение # 3 |
Admin
Группа: Администраторы
Сообщений: 1801
Статус: Offline
| по макросам здесь врядли кто поможет
|
|
|
|
адвокат | Дата: Вторник, 29.12.2009, 11:37 | Сообщение # 4 |
Группа: Пользователи
Сообщений: 10
Статус: Offline
| огромное спасибо. все равно, если вдруг на иных сайтах сделают - выложу сюда...
|
|
|
|
адвокат | Дата: Вторник, 29.12.2009, 17:12 | Сообщение # 5 |
Группа: Пользователи
Сообщений: 10
Статус: Offline
| Думал, что все нормалек, но.... внес данные и понял что не все так гладко: внеся все данные обнаружил, что некоторые ссылки не работаю..., вернее сказать работают но не корректно... ... вкладка форма выбирая отправителя в данных организация не проставляется информация... например есть три Крыловских - просто (-), адвокат и представитель по доверенности. почему то не меняется если выбираешь адвоката или представителя по доверенности... тоже самое и с получателем отправлений..., если идет несколько подряд одноименных получателей, то последующие почему-то не воспринимаются... помощь оказывали: с сайта: http://excel-vba.ru, автор:Дмитрий (Site Admin) с сайта: http://forum.msexcel.ru, автор: m и автор cheshiki1
Сообщение отредактировал адвокат - Вторник, 29.12.2009, 17:13 |
|
|
|
адвокат | Дата: Вторник, 29.12.2009, 17:34 | Сообщение # 6 |
Группа: Пользователи
Сообщений: 10
Статус: Offline
| да, чуть не забыл.... шрифты....
|
|
|
|
адвокат | Дата: Понедельник, 11.01.2010, 11:56 | Сообщение # 7 |
Группа: Пользователи
Сообщений: 10
Статус: Offline
| уважаемые гуру Excel... Вновь с просьбой, помочь доделать одну малость - поменять функцию... понимаю что это для вас мелочь, но для меня эта мелочь является непреодалимым препятствием. сущность проблемы: Думал, что все нормалек, но.... внес данные и понял что не все так гладко: внеся все данные обнаружил, что некоторые ссылки не работаю..., вернее сказать работают но не корректно... ... вкладка форма выбирая отправителя в данных организация не проставляется информация... например есть три Крыловских - просто (-), адвокат и представитель по доверенности. почему то не меняется если выбираешь адвоката или представителя по доверенности... тоже самое и с получателем отправлений..., если идет несколько подряд одноименных получателей, то последующие почему то не воспринимаются... Ссылка для скачивания файла Печать конвертов (MS Excel 2007) образец.zip http://file.qip.ru/file/114206482/88003e69/___MS_Excel_2007__.html ( 60.01 Кб )
Сообщение отредактировал адвокат - Понедельник, 11.01.2010, 11:56 |
|
|
|
DV68 | Дата: Понедельник, 11.01.2010, 15:01 | Сообщение # 8 |
Группа: Модераторы
Сообщений: 648
Статус: Offline
| Я думаю, если после отчества Крыловского - адвоката поставить пробел, то будет все норм (Крыловский 3-й - два пробела в конце)
|
|
|
|
адвокат | Дата: Понедельник, 11.01.2010, 16:32 | Сообщение # 9 |
Группа: Пользователи
Сообщений: 10
Статус: Offline
|
|
|
|
|
DV68 | Дата: Понедельник, 11.01.2010, 16:49 | Сообщение # 10 |
Группа: Модераторы
Сообщений: 648
Статус: Offline
| =СМЕЩ(Первый_получ;ПОИСКПОЗ($B$16;Кому;0)-1;1;СЧЁТЕСЛИ(Кому;$B$16);)
|
|
|
|
адвокат | Дата: Вторник, 12.01.2010, 12:49 | Сообщение # 11 |
Группа: Пользователи
Сообщений: 10
Статус: Offline
| ИТОГ: все вроде как работает... однако: лист - ФОРМА - окно - отправитель: с одной стороны удобно что есть выбор (организации) с другой стороны создает куче неудобств в том, что имея в наличии одну фирму с разными адресами возникает сложность с их выбором... лист ФОРМА - окно - получатель уведомления: в связи со сложностью функциями сделать так что бы происходили изменения получателя, но в связи с тем, что функция выбирает только верхнюю позицию, то остальные остаются незадейственными лист ФОРМА - окно - получатель отправления: выбирая: Кому (Организация) наименование получателя платежа Кому (должность) далее выбираем кто будет получать Кому (ФИО) (заполняется автоматом исходя из (организация+должность) индекс(заполняется автоматом исходя из (организация+должность) Адрес(заполняется автоматом исходя из (организация+должность) минусы - при смене всплывающего окна в наименовании получателя платежа, массив не всегда обновляется... тем самым постоянно нужно проверять - произошло обновление данных или нет.... в связи с чем возникает вопрос: в чем была допущена ошибка в построении базы??? для примера выкладываю то что было в опен офисе и то что получилось в Excel. жду советов. Ссылка для скачивания файла печать конвертов.zip http://file.qip.ru/file/115732156/2703156/__online.html ( 474.97 Кб ) _________________ адвокат ICQ#: 249546690
|
|
|
|
адвокат | Дата: Пятница, 22.01.2010, 13:53 | Сообщение # 12 |
Группа: Пользователи
Сообщений: 10
Статус: Offline
| и тишина....
|
|
|
|
DV68 | Дата: Пятница, 22.01.2010, 15:13 | Сообщение # 13 |
Группа: Модераторы
Сообщений: 648
Статус: Offline
| Решения выкладывались, но если человек хочет сделать все чужими руками и не пытается сам разобраться в вопросе, то и помогать ему не хочется. Тем более когда видишь одно и то же на пяти сайтах одновременно.
|
|
|
|
адвокат | Дата: Пятница, 22.01.2010, 18:01 | Сообщение # 14 |
Группа: Пользователи
Сообщений: 10
Статус: Offline
| DIM5955, честно сказать вы ничего не делали.... если уж на то пошло то единственным кто что то сделал это с сайта http://excel-vba.ru/forum/viewtopic.php?p=436#436 - администратор Дмитрий... на как я полагаю, ссылаться на его успехи нет совсем корректно. а относительно того что я сам не пытаюсь разобраться - это сугубо ваше мнение. далее продолжать дискуссию с вами не считаю целесообразным.
|
|
|
|
DV68 | Дата: Пятница, 22.01.2010, 19:29 | Сообщение # 15 |
Группа: Модераторы
Сообщений: 648
Статус: Offline
| Насчет того, что не хотите сами разбираться, беру свои слова обратно. Просто когда это стало похоже на спам, я перестал следить за темой. А тишина возможна потому, что файла по ссылке за 12.01 уже нет.
|
|
|
|
<script type="text/javascript">teasernet_blockid = 656993;teasernet_padid = 271069;</script><script type="text/javascript" src="http://bzlwe.com/07f6/bad6484c927/07.js"></script>
|